How they compare
Barbados currently reports 156 t against 144 t in Kyrgyzstan, a difference of 12 t.
That makes Barbados's figure about 1.1 times Kyrgyzstan's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Barbados ahead.
Barbados ranks 168th and Kyrgyzstan ranks 169th of 224 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Barbados averaged higher in 2 and Kyrgyzstan in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Barbados | Kyrgyzstan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 27.67 t | 113.5 t | 85.83 t |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2000s | 753.5 t | 380.2 t | 373.3 t | Barbados |
| 2010s | 895.5 t | 598.8 t | 296.7 t | Barbados |
| 2020s | 222.6 t | 844.4 t | 621.8 t | Kyrgyzst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products. More detailed information on wood products, including definitions, can be found at: https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en
